Farmers, Schools Scramble for Propane
Cold Snap Stretching Supplies of Propane, Causing Transportation Bottlenecks
A cold snap is stretching supplies of propane gas and causing transportation bottlenecks across a broad section of the United States, officials said Friday, sending everyone from rural educators to chicken farmers in search of enough fuel to keep warm.
